Rachmaninov’s titanic Third Piano Concerto is seen by pianists as one of their greatest challenges. However, its mighty technical demands are more than matched by the warmth and richness of its glorious melodies.
The brilliant Fourth Symphony by Tchaikovsky gives us a spectral waltz, a country song, a pizzicato polka, a recurring and terrifying ‘Fate’ motive, and perhaps the most exciting ending in all symphonic music.
